MasterChef shares FIVE different and delicious recipes for mac and cheese

MasterChef shares FIVE delicious recipes for the humble mac and cheese after celebrity chef Massimo Bottura shared his favourite

Massimo Bottura shared his mouthwatering mac and cheese recipe on Tuesday’s episode of MasterChef.

The 58-year-old Italian chef detailed his recipe ahead of a mac and cheese cooking task assigned to the show’s contestants. 

And it was just one of five hunger-inducing mac and cheese recipes which featured on the MasterChef website. 

Compliments to the chef: Massimo Bottura (pictured) shared his mouthwatering mac and cheese recipe on Tuesday’s episode of MasterChef

Massimo Bottura’s Mac and Cheese dish combines cheeses including Taleggio, Gorgonzola, Pecorino and Parmigiano-Reggiano.

He also uses fresh white truffle and balsamic vinegar for added flavour.

‘I’m going to add some blue cheese. This is adding a lot of deepness,’ Massimo told the show’s contestants.

As he detailed his recipe, judge Melissa Leong was left visibly impressed, salivating over the various ingredients. 

Fellow judge Andy Allen had earlier shared his own mac and cheese recipe on the MasterChef website.

Andy Allen’s Cauliflower Mac and Cheese uses a variety of vegetables, such as cauliflower, leek and garlic.

He also uses Gruyère cheese, smoked cheddar and anchovy fillets, injecting a salty flavour into the classic dish. 

Another take on the humble mac and cheese, which features on the MasterChef website, is the Triple Hog Mac & Cheese.

The dish features a three pork mix, including pork belly, pancetta and bacon, a cheese sauce, macaroni and sweet corn base, and anchovy and sage crumb.

The Porky Mac & Cheese with Porky Cream, Parmesan Crisp also uses pancetta, and features a crisp layer of fried parmesan on the top. 

The Spanish Mac & Cheese appears to be another favourite in the MasterChef kitchen, and features diced chorizo, garlic and Spanish onion.

‘Try this oozy Spanish mac and cheese featuring smoked chorizos, tomatoes and a variety of mouth-watering spices – it can’t get any better than this!’ reads the description.
